Output 99d301232fb95407e24ea3b4807e608c8e0ae7500a28a41d17c0797b2d91fac2:0

value
119447016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a2ce70016c0fffe118370595f8b432bcc9b697 OP_EQUAL
address
35aTLb2C4JVJiWjdbUpNQytmq1w66zS4qM
transaction
99d301232fb95407e24ea3b4807e608c8e0ae7500a28a41d17c0797b2d91fac2
confirmations
286601
spent
true